Performance and Picture Quality
The Projector Smart Projector 4K Supported boasts a brightness of 1500 lumens and supports 4K resolution for stunning visuals. This projector also features a 98% NTSC colour gamut, ensuring vibrant and true-to-life colours. In contrast, the Mini Projector, while supporting 4K and 1080P formats, has a native resolution of 720P. It employs new LCD projection technology to enhance screen contrast and colour accuracy, making it suitable for casual viewing but not on par with the 4K capabilities of the Lisowod model.
Audio Experience
Audio quality is a crucial aspect of any home theatre setup. The Projector Smart Projector includes a powerful built-in 35W Dolby Audio system, delivering immersive sound that eliminates the need for external speakers. On the other hand, the Mini Projector features built-in HiFi speakers and supports two-way Bluetooth 5.2 for connecting to external audio devices. While the Mini Projector offers decent sound, it cannot match the robust audio performance of the Lisowod projector.
Smart Features and User Interface
The Projector Smart Projector is equipped with CinemOS, providing access to over 800 apps and a wealth of content, including live TV channels without subscriptions. Its flagship LX3 AI chip ensures a smooth user interface, making navigation seamless. Conversely, the Mini Projector has built-in Android Smart TV OS, allowing access to millions of videos without additional devices. However, it lacks the extensive app library and the advanced performance features that come with the Lisowod model.
Connectivity Options
Connectivity can significantly enhance your viewing experience. The Projector Smart Projector features next-gen WiFi 6, allowing for lag-free streaming and smooth performance while playing games on consoles like the PS5 or Xbox. Additionally, it has Bidirectional Bluetooth 5.2 for connecting soundbars and headphones. The Mini Projector also comes with dual-band WiFi 6 and Bluetooth capabilities but lacks the advanced streaming performance of the Lisowod model.
Portability and Ease of Use
Portability is another factor to consider. The Mini Projector is designed for easy transport, featuring a 180° rotatable design and auto keystone correction for quick setup in various environments. Its compact size and lightweight design make it perfect for movie nights on the go. In contrast, the Projector Smart Projector, while offering an all-in-one solution for home use, is less portable due to its larger size and features aimed more at stationary setups.
